What Causes Dizziness, Balance Problems And Shortness Of Breath?

Hi. I have had some health problems for over 2 yrs. I have had dizzy spells,balance problems,shortness of breath. Lately I have new symptoms along with these. They are stiffness in my hands and legs. Also aching legs at night and numbness in my feet,hands and face. I have had heart tests,brain tests. No doctors here know what s wrong. Please help me. My heart rate also goes between 120 and 145 when I m upset or walking up steps. It s can be 102 non while I m sitting. I just realized I have to pay. I can t afford to. I guess I will have to pray for someone to find what is wrong some more.:(

Neurologist 's  Response
Hello!
Thank you for your question on HCM! I understand your concern.
In my opinion your problems may be related to hyperthyroidism or just anxiety.
It is normal for the heart rate to raise during physical activity, but your baseline heart rate is a little high. This combined to the other neurological symptoms raises the suspicion of a metabolic problem like a hyperthyroidism.
The pain in your legs and numbness, the gait problems, may be caused by a possible polyneuropathy.
I would recommend a full blood work, a thyroid function test and an Electroneurography to rule out a possible polyneuropathy.
